I took the basic med exam last week and passed with a 94%. It really is not that bad. I studied for about a week using Lehne's Pharmacology for Nursing as my main resource. I also used an old NCLEX book to brush up on med administration procedures. If you study the basics of what the drug is used for, side effects and nusring indications you will be fine! There were no surprises on the test- nothing came up that wasn't on the study guide. Good luck!!
